Lee HI-BAR Inlet Safety Screens save space and weight by incorporating the inlet screen directly into the boss fitting end rather than the more traditional approach of having the inlet screen installed in the manifold directly below the fitting. This unique design also offers greater flow and dirt holding capacity than a design that completely encapsulates the screen in the fitting. Lee HI-BAR Inlet Safety Screens are machined entirely from 15-5PH stainless steel and are rugged enough to withstand pressure differentials up to 6000 psi without burst or collapse. Each component is 100% proof pressure tested before shipment to ensure reliable performance. These screens are available in -4, -6, -8, and -10 configurations (AS33514 flareless tube to AS930 port fitting ends), which can be installed into a standard boss per AS33649 or equivalent. Eight standard hole sizes ranging from 50 to 500 micron are available.

The Lee Company has developed the Lohm Laws for defining and measuring resistance to fluid flow. The Lohm is defined such that 1 Lohm will flow 100 GPM of water with a pressure drop of 25 psi at a temperature of 80°F.
Always verify flow calculations by experiment.
